Partager via


DataConnectionDialog.EncryptedConnectionString, propriété

Extrait ou définit les informations de connexion chiffrée pour la boîte de dialogue pour le fournisseur de données spécifié.

Espace de noms :  Microsoft.VisualStudio.Data
Assembly :  Microsoft.VisualStudio.Data (dans Microsoft.VisualStudio.Data.dll)

Syntaxe

'Déclaration
Public MustOverride Property EncryptedConnectionString As String
public abstract string EncryptedConnectionString { get; set; }
public:
virtual property String^ EncryptedConnectionString {
    String^ get () abstract;
    void set (String^ value) abstract;
}
abstract EncryptedConnectionString : string with get, set
abstract function get EncryptedConnectionString () : String 
abstract function set EncryptedConnectionString (value : String)

Valeur de propriété

Type : String
Retourne les informations de connexion chiffrée représentées par la boîte de dialogue pour le fournisseur sélectionné.

Notes

Normalement un client affecte à cette propriété pour spécifier une première configuration dans la boîte de dialogue, et l'extrait ensuite une fois la boîte de dialogue se soit fermé pour prendre les informations entrées par l'utilisateur.

La chaîne de connexion chiffrée contient toutes les informations, y compris les mots de passe s'ils sont choisis pour être enregistrés. Le chiffrement utilisé est l'API normale de protection des données (DPAPI), qui peut être déchiffré par l'utilisateur qui l'a chiffrée, et sur le même ordinateur. Par conséquent, cette chaîne est très utile dans une session d' Visual Studio, ou une fois persistante à un fichier spécifique à l'utilisateur qui n'est jamais copié vers un ordinateur différent.

Sécurité .NET Framework

Voir aussi

Référence

DataConnectionDialog Classe

Microsoft.VisualStudio.Data, espace de noms

DisplayConnectionString